The Barry M Strobe Cream highlight is something I knew I had to pick up when I saw it on other blogs - I'm a complete sucker for a new highlight, particularly a cream, and this product has not disappointed me at all. I got the shade 'Iced Bronze' and although its a different tone to High Beam by Benefit, the two look amazing layered together, creating a gorgeous glow that could pretty much be seen from space. I also grabbed the Brow Kit from the Barry M stand, since I've been investing in a few more brow products recently; this shade is perfect for a brunette, and I particularly love the wax to set the brows in shape (I've been complimented on my brows by my Grandma since I started using this, and I think if your grandparents approve, its all good.) 

 
The Colour Elixir Glosses from Max Factor are something I've had my eye on for a while, the packaging is beautiful and the shade range is pretty darn good for a drugstore variety. I won't go into too much detail since I've got a separate post coming up based on these, but the two shades I picked up were 'Lustrous Sands' and 'Glossy Toffee'. The second I actually got in a free set when you spent over £15, and I also got this Eye Luminizer product, which I've got to be honest, I haven't yet tried! (But I probably should - if there's one product I need following exams, its an eye brightener to fix those dark circles.) The last thing I picked up from the stand was the 'Crème Puff' powder in Transparent, which I don't have a photo of but is pretty much your average face powder - I can't say I'm a huge fan of the powder as it smells a bit odd, but that's probably because I'm such a devoted fan of the Rimmel Translucent powder.

 
Now obviously if your local Boots has acquired a NYX stand, it would be rude not to have a look and pick up a couple of bits (I've since purchased five more items, actually help me). I absolutely adore the Butter Glosses, so I got the shade 'Fortune Cookie', and I picked up the powder blush in Taupe, which works wonders as a cool toned contour powder for my especially pale days. I think NYX is my favourite stand in the shop now, you can't beat the quality for the prices and I feel just as satisfied buying a new Butter Gloss as I do splashing out on a Benefit gloss.
